What usually causes it in Joliet
Joliet's mix of aging infrastructure and river-corridor geography creates real flood exposure during major storms. Older basements take on combined seepage and sewer backup; river-adjacent properties get genuine flood-water intrusion. Both are contaminated water that needs sanitization, not just pumping.

What changes the flood cleanup plan
Joliet flood cleanup starts with contamination assessment. River and sewer-related water gets PPE, removal of porous materials, and antimicrobial treatment before drying. Industrial floors get high-volume extraction and structural drying scaled to the floorplate.
What matters for the claim
Flood and stormwater intrusion are usually excluded from standard property policies. Coverage requires a separate flood policy or specific endorsement. We document water height, source pathway, and contamination level for the carrier and any disaster-relief programs.

What to do right now

  1. 1

    Keep everyone out of the affected lower level in Joliet until power is confirmed safe and the flood source is understood.

  2. 2

    Photograph water height, floor drains, window wells, entry points, and the first contents touched in older basements in established residential neighborhoods.

  3. 3

    Do not run HVAC or household fans through the flooded area until the contamination category is evaluated.

Is Joliet basement floodwater contaminated?

Usually yes — most basement floods in Joliet involve sewer backup or stormwater. We assume Category 2 or 3 until we can confirm clean source, because mistaking contaminated water for clean leads to mold and health issues.
